The state's highest court established long ago that women have the same right as men to appear topless in public. Absent a link to some commercial enterprise or promotion, the woman's lack of certain attire in this instance does not appear to be a police matter.
If so, Congressman Anthony Weiner doesn't need to employ social media to display his chest. He can do it publicly.
